Luke Mitchell's Rise to Fame: From Summer Bay to Hollywood

Luke Mitchell's journey is a compelling narrative of talent, hard work, and strategic career choices. His breakout role as a teen heartthrob on the iconic Australian soap opera, Home and Away, catapulted him into the spotlight. This wasn't merely a matter of good looks; Mitchell demonstrated genuine acting prowess, laying the foundation for a thriving international career. His subsequent roles in shows like The Originals and Blindspot solidified his status as a recognizable and versatile actor, captivating audiences across the globe. Pinpointing a precise net worth for Luke Mitchell is challenging. The entertainment industry is notoriously tight-lipped about financial details, making accurate estimations difficult. Online figures vary wildly – often driven by speculation rather than concrete data. While some reports suggest a net worth in the range of $2.5 million around mid-2021, this is just an approximation. Such figures don't account for taxes, agent fees, living expenses, or personal investments, all of which significantly impact an actor's actual financial situation. Consequently, any stated number should be considered a rough estimate at best. How much is he really worth? The true answer remains elusive.
